Maid Faces
Charges
For Poisoning Baby
With Clorox
|

Brunei High Court |
Bandar Seri
Begawan An Indonesian maid who allegedly mixed bleach
(Clorox) with rice porridge she gave a baby boy was remanded at the
Central Police Station for a week for further investigations.

Brunei Ruler Conferred
Laos
Highest Medal
|

His Majesty with Lao President Mr Khamtay Siphandone |
Vientiane
His Majesty Sultan Haji Hassanal Bolkiah of Brunei was
conferred Laos' highest medal, Phoxay Lane Xang by the Lao President
Mr Khamtay Siphandone.

Ukraine's top
court weighs election appeal
Kiev - Ukraine's Supreme Court on Monday considered an
opposition appeal against the official results from a bitterly
disputed presidential election amid fears the conflict could lead to
the breakup of the former Soviet republic. |

Alcohol may
raise risk of irregular heartbeat
Chicago - Drinking alcohol on a regular basis may slightly
raise men's risk of developing a type of irregular heartbeat known as
atrial fibrillation or atrial flutter, according to a large new Danish
study. |
